This newly discovered species of tiny fish has been named after United States president Barrack Obama. (dailymail.co.uk)
United States president Barrack Obama has more reasons to smile these days.
A recently discovered new species of fish has been named after him by the researchers who found it. According to reports, the freshwater fish has a unique bright orange and blue colors features and usually found in the fast-flowing rivers around America. Sources said the fish named after Obama was called darter, considered as the smallest member of the perch family.
It was learned that the president is one of the four presidents to have newly discovered fish named after them. Based on internet facts, the the remaining four species have been named after three other presidents and one vice-president. The tiny fish which is normally under 50mm in length have been discovered earlier by researchers from Geosyntec Consultants and Saint Louis University in waters in Arkansas, Kansas, Kentucky, Missouri, Oklahoma, and Tennessee.
